In electronics, an LED circuit or LED driver is an electrical circuit used to power a light-emitting diode (LED). The circuit must provide sufficient current supply (either DC or AC, see below) to light the LED at the required brightness, but must limit the current to prevent damaging the LED. The voltage drop across an LED is approximately constant over a wide range of operating current; therefore, a small increase in applied voltage greatly increases the current. Very simple circuits are used for low-power indicator LEDs. More complex, current source circuits are required when driving high-power LEDs for illumination to achieve correct current regulation.

LED drive device with stable performance

The invention discloses an LED drive device with stable performance. The LED drive device comprises an input protection circuit, a step-down circuit, a rectifier and filter circuit and a voltage-dividing and current-limiting resistor, which are electrically connected, wherein the voltage-dividing and current-limiting resistor is used for carrying out current limiting on an LED light source circuit and carrying out current limiting protection on an LED, so that the LED works under the drive of stable voltage and current; and the service lifetime of the LED is ensured. A filter capacitor in the rectifier and filter circuit is a tantalum electrolytic capacitor; and the filter capacitor is relatively small in volume and stable in performance under the conditions of the same withstand voltage and electric capacity, can still keep good electrical performance after long-time working and can prolong the service lifetime of an LED drive circuit. A discharge chip resistor is arranged in the filter capacitor; and after a power supply is cut off, the chip resistor can discharge the electricity stored in a capacitor core within a short period of time, and reduces the voltage of the capacitor core to zero, so that bleeder resistors do not need to be connected with two ends of the filter capacitor in parallel; and the circuit for driving the power supply is relatively simple.

The invention discloses an anti-misoperation device of an electromagnetic lock by monitoring the leakage current of an arrester. A high-voltage presence indication device comprises a three-phase current sensor, a TVS (Transient Voltage Suppressor), a three-phase amplification filter circuit, a master MCU (Microprogrammed Control Unit), an LED (Light Emitting Diode) circuit and a lockout circuit, wherein the LED circuit comprises an LED driving circuit and an LED main circuit; the lockout circuit comprises a lockout driving circuit and an electromagnetic lock main circuit; the output end of the three-phase current sensor is respectively connected with the input end of the TVS and the input end of the three-phase amplification filter circuit; the output end of the three-phase amplification filter circuit is connected with the input end of the master MCU; the output end of the master MCU is respectively connected with the input end of the LED driving circuit and the input end of the lockout driving circuit; the output end of the LED driving circuit is connected with the input end of the LED main circuit; and the output end of the lockout driving circuit is respectively connected with the input end of the electromagnetic lock main circuit. High-voltage equipment can realize installation and maintenance of the high-voltage presence indication device without power cut.
